The Wine Advocate
92
“Beaurenard's special cuvée, the 2022 Chateauneuf du Pape Blanc Boisrenard, is mainly Clairette Blanche (42%) and Roussanne (32%), with 11% Bourboulenc, 10% Grenache Blanc, and 1% each of Clairette Rose, Grenache Gris, Picardan, Picpoul Blanc and Picpoul Gris. Matured in foudres and older barriques, it delivers scents of pear, melon and citrus, not of wood, with ample weight, a fine sense of balance and a silky, lingering finish...”
